Mean Arena Quits D3 Project - Mods Posted by: Jamie on 12-27-2004 @ 23:45 |
 |
This News Item has been viewed 1582 times! It seems that the person at Mean Arena has decided to call the quits for his project. Hes posted up a really long message that I won't explain to you but show you instead. Here's what he had to say:
Quote: Just thought I'd let the community know what's up with the Quake 2 Remix Mod I've had in production. It was originally stated to be the first 3 levels of Quake 2 done in DOOM 3 fashion, and so far has turned out pretty good. First 2 levels were completely built, while the 3rd was still a work in progress as it was much larger than the first 2. Unfortunately, I will be ending this mod short, and it won't be released. It's pretty bad when you start out with a group of 10 people wanting to do work on the mod, then weeks and weeks go by wondering where the work is at people are supposed to be working on, and then they either claim they don't want to do it, or just ignore my emails no matter how hard I've tried to make their job as easy as possible. Other people that actually did do the work they said they would, produced really well, and I thank them for that. Another reason I'm ending the mod short, (as well as all my other DOOM 3 work) is the definite lack of support. I never get any email replies from id Software, and that's no way to be to your most dedicated community members. Also, our music people just seem to ignore our emails now as well. I love the same ring of people and ignored emails. I have many hunches why, but I'll keep that to myself. Now onto the technical aspects of why the mod is being cut short. I've pretty much learned DOOM 3 technology inside and out, (which now has all been in vien) and on a technical (lighting side) DOOM 3 is only good for making mods if they are like DOOM 3. Because of the lighting limitations, there will always be many dark patches in your levels that will require some sort of flashlight or torch. This keeps the creativity to a minimum as you pretty much have to build your levels around the renderer. Unless of course you're a licensee of the DOOM 3 tech, then of course you can make engine modifications to combat the lighting issues. So in lighting the new Quake 2 maps, there are 2 options I was given. Either make them very, very dark that require a flashlight and Quake 2 doesn't have a flashlight, or light them very well to be able to see everything, and the levels run very, very poor.
